=========================================================================== Advanced engine needed : DSDA-Doom / GZDoom / Eternity Engine / Helion (see "Tested with") Primary purpose : Single player =========================================================================== Title : Thorium Filename : THORIUM.WAD Release date : 09/12/25 Author : Jacek Nowak Email Address : [redacted] Other Files By Author : Yttrium, Iron, Sulfur, Nitrogen, Radium... Misc. Author Info : Makes Doom maps :) Description : Relatively large non-linear map. Estimated playtime: around 1 hour. Designed for classic gameplay (no jumping, freelook is ok but not required).
